.NET SEO - 一个客观公正角度的探讨

发布日期:2023-06-25 17:43:17浏览次数:252

.NET SEO - 一个客观公正角度的探讨

在今天的数字时代,互联网已经成为了商业和社交活动的重要平台。对于在线业务来说,搜索引擎优化(SEO)是提高品牌可见性和获取更多目标受众的关键策略之一。然而,针对使用.NET编程语言开发的网站进行优化却是一个特殊的挑战。本文将以客观公正的角度,探讨关于.NET SEO的相关问题。

.NET框架的优势

.NET框架是微软公司开发的一种软件开发框架,它为开发人员提供了一种强大且灵活的工具来创建各种类型的应用程序。.NET具有良好的安全性、稳定性和可靠性,以及广泛的第三方库和组件支持。在.NET框架下开发的网站通常拥有良好的性能和用户体验。

对.NET SEO的挑战

然而,相比于其他编程语言,.NET在SEO方面面临一些挑战。主要原因是搜索引擎对于动态生成的内容和URL的索引能力相对较弱。由于.NET网站通常依赖服务器端处理和动态生成页面内容,搜索引擎爬虫在索引这些页面时可能会遇到困难。

另一个挑战是.NET网站的URL结构。由于.NET框架的默认URL结构包含复杂的查询字符串参数,这使得URL不易被用户和搜索引擎理解和记忆。这可能导致搜索引擎优化的困难以及用户体验的下降。

.NET SEO的解决方案

尽管存在挑战,但有许多方法可以提高.NET网站的SEO效果。

首先,使用友好的URL结构。通过优化URL,将查询字符串参数转化为有意义的关键字,可以提高搜索引擎对网站的理解和索引能力。这可以通过URL重写和路由规则来实现。

其次,生成静态HTML页面。通过在关键页面上生成静态HTML版本并将其提供给搜索引擎爬虫,可以使搜索引擎更容易索引和理解网站内容。这可以使用缓存技术、页面快照或者使用预渲染服务来实现。

此外,确保网站结构清晰,并使用合适的标记和元数据。良好的网站结构能够提供良好的导航和用户体验,而合适的标记和元数据则能够为搜索引擎提供准确的信息以及更好的理解页面内容。

总结

尽管.NET网站在SEO方面面临一些挑战,但通过采用合适的优化策略,可以更大限度地提高网站的可见性和排名。使用友好的URL结构、生成静态HTML页面以及优化网站结构和标记,都是提高.NET SEO效果的重要方法。

同时,持续关注搜索引擎算法的变化和更佳实践的更新,也是确保.NET网站持续获得良好SEO效果的关键。通过不断优化和改进,.NET网站可以在竞争激烈的在线市场中脱颖而出并吸引更多的目标受众。

如果您有什么问题,欢迎咨询技术员 点击QQ咨询